Study Notes
Cholesterol Biosynthesis Stages
- Cholesterol biosynthesis occurs in five distinct stages.
- The synthesis of mevalonate marks the initiation of cholesterol biosynthesis.
- Mevalonate is formed from acetyl CoA.
- The isoprenoid unit is formed from mevalonate in the second stage.
- Six isoprenoid units condense to produce squalene.
- Squalene undergoes cyclization to form lanosterol, the parent steroid.
- Cholesterol is finally formed from lanosterol in the last stage.
